HE DIDN’T RUN AWAY FROM THE BATTLE LIKE OTHERS DID (Friday, 28th November 2025)

Test for Today: 1 Sam. 17:48-54 “So it was, when the philistine arose and came and drew near to meet David, that David hurried and ran towards the army to meet the philistine” (vs.48).

Overcoming challenges; obstacles and hurdles of life is what develop in us the qualities needed to fulfill God’s plan for our lives. David had been a constant conqueror even before he came in contact with Goliath of Gath.  In 1 Sam. 17:34-36, David recounted his past victories before King Saul when he tried to dissuade him from confronting Goliath. What he did was to celebrate his past testimonies. He said while he was tending his father’s sheep, a beer and a lion came to devour the sheep but he smote them with his bare hand and he said this uncircumcised philistine will be like them.

Beloved, David was able to conquer Goliath because he had been able to conquer those wild animals. Until you conquer your lion and your bear, your Goliath will not appear. And do you know what happened after David killed Goliath? He became the rave of the moment, and the whole nation celebrated him. If you can’t kill your lion and the bear in the secret no one will give you a Goliath in the open. There are people looking up to you, don’t disappoint them by hiding in the cave like king Saul did for forty days and forty nights, so likewise the whole army of Israel. However, when David defeated Goliath the whole army of Israel became motivated, charged and defeated their own enemies. When you fail to conquer your Goliath people behind you will never become victorious. As you step out today, I charge you to go all out and defeat those lions and bears for a Goliath that will take you to your throne to show forth.

You are a Champion!
